George Orwell was first and foremost an essayist, producing throughout his life an extraordinary array of short nonfiction that reflected--and illuminated--the fraught times in which he lived.
This is a generous display of the great English journalist’s distinctive honesty, clarity and reverence for the pertinent fact and the perfect phrase.
